How Rob runs games

I like a blend of roleplay and tactical combat, with a heavy emphasis on story. I am a storyteller, and for me that comes first. My ratio of gameplay would be about 50% roleplay / 30% exploration & investigation / 20% combat. Player choices have a tremendous impact on the story; no railroading here. I tend to blend a linear story plot with some sandboxing. I like to think that I come to the table with George Lucas's 1974 "The Adventures of the Starkiller" treatment, and at the table, we turn it into "Star Wars". Characters of all stripes thrive in my games: Deeply developed characters with personal goals, team-oriented adventurers, morally gray antiheroes, larger-than-life pulp heroes, etc. I can easily handle a party with a mix of these. I like fast, cinematic combat and prefer when it serves the story. What makes my games different from other GMs is my rich NPCs with distinct personalities, my strong world-building, historical/canonical authenticity when applicable, character-driven storytelling and long-running campaigns where player choices have consequences.
